Why does my dog need regular grooming?

Frequent grooming of your pet not only keeps your pet’s hair looking soft, but it also helps maintain your pet’s skin and physical health and comfort. When your dog gets grooming, it helps it avoid painful matting and knots in their hair, reduces the spread of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thepet clear from pests like fleas. Within your dog’s grooming appointment, your Kathleen pet groomer will look out for bumps and injuries that could be a health issue.


How frequently should your dog be groomed?

Grooming requirements for your pet will vary depending on the breed, fur and your pet’s habits. Normally, dogs with short coats like Beagles, Bulldogs and Labradors need less grooming than dogs with long coats such as Poodles, Border Collies and Pomeranians. Commonly, most pet owners book frequent grooming every month. For puppies and dogs who have never been groomed before, more regular burshing at home should be done to get them used to being handled and to avoid grooming problems into adulthood. What’s the difference between a pet bathing and grooming service?

Pet bathing services include: 1-3 cycles of shampoo, 1 round of conditioner, hand-dry as permitted by dog, brush and/or combing.

Pet grooming incorporate: Everything included above in bathing plus a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your specific wants, nails cut, and ears cleaned.

Can I stay with my pet whilst it is being groomed?

For a better experience for your dog and for their protection it is imperative that the dog groomer have your pet’s full attention. Most dogs are distracted by their owners attendance and will behave so much better without their owners being with them. Discuss any worries you have with the pet groomer in Kathleen FL when you bring your pet in, and then swiftly and fuss-free give your pet to them. If you extend the process, your dog will pick up on your stress and become more stressed themselves.

How old should my pup be before he gets his 1st groom?

It is good to have your pup end up being acquainted with grooming as young as possible after the first series of puppy shots, typically 12-16 weeks old. This will assist him discover at an early age that grooming is an enjoyable experience.

Should you trim the hair around a dog’s eyes?

Trimming the pet dog’s hair which covers the eyes is essential, not only to enable the dog to have better vision, however also to avoid this falling against the eye and causing irritation. The density of the hair on the pet’s nose can also get too lengthy and block the pet dog’s eyesight from the corners.

How do you groom a distressed pet?

Start with brushing or rubbing a distressed dog. Let pets investigate and smell tools. Gradually present grooming tools; run clippers to get the dog familiar to the sound prior to utilizing or utilize quiet clippers that don’t make loud noises. Go slowly, be gentle, ensure clippers and blow dryers are not too hot for your pet.

Is it OKAY to use conditioner on dogs?

Just like hair shampoo, it is important to use just doggie conditioners on your pet. The veterinarians caution pet owners that human grooming products, whether conditioner or bar soap, can lead to unpleasant skin inflammation in pets.
